summ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orFlorian Westphal <fw@strlen.de>2017-10-26 14:26:41 +0200
committerFlorian Westphal <fw@strlen.de>2017-10-26 23:46:10 +0200
commit07da331f27f9331475cdf685ec27fef42a6887d5 (patch)
tree72721ec0071732284937a504aafaf18a0646f36c
parent26645d805b13dbb1db91773571b8d01e3213bda0 (diff)
tests: icmpX: fix expected output
both of these rules succeed, but they should fail instead. nft removes the ip6 nexthdr' clause, but this is not correct, it is an explicit test for the ipv6 nexthdr value. Implicit dependencies use meta l4proto to skip extension headers (if any), ipv6 nexthdr does not. Signed-off-by: Florian Westphal <fw@strlen.de>
-rw-r--r--tests/py/bridge/icmpX.t2
-rw-r--r--tests/py/inet/icmpX.t2
2 files changed, 2 insertions, 2 deletions
diff --git a/tests/py/bridge/icmpX.t b/tests/py/bridge/icmpX.t
index 8c0a5979..4d7b9b06 100644
--- a/tests/py/bridge/icmpX.t
+++ b/tests/py/bridge/icmpX.t
@@ -4,5 +4,5 @@
ip protocol icmp icmp type echo-request;ok;icmp type echo-request
icmp type echo-request;ok
-ip6 nexthdr icmpv6 icmpv6 type echo-request;ok;icmpv6 type echo-request
+ip6 nexthdr icmpv6 icmpv6 type echo-request;ok;ip6 nexthdr 58 icmpv6 type echo-request
icmpv6 type echo-request;ok
diff --git a/tests/py/inet/icmpX.t b/tests/py/inet/icmpX.t
index 1b467a18..aebaf099 100644
--- a/tests/py/inet/icmpX.t
+++ b/tests/py/inet/icmpX.t
@@ -4,5 +4,5 @@
ip protocol icmp icmp type echo-request;ok;icmp type echo-request
icmp type echo-request;ok
-ip6 nexthdr icmpv6 icmpv6 type echo-request;ok;icmpv6 type echo-request
+ip6 nexthdr icmpv6 icmpv6 type echo-request;ok;ip6 nexthdr 58 icmpv6 type echo-request
icmpv6 type echo-request;ok